Sterling Heights Historical Commission February 5, 2015 40433 Utica Road Sterling Heights, MI 48313 Minutes of Meeting I. Call to Order Meeting was called to order at 6 p.m. II. Roll Call Present: John Connor, Frank DiMaria, Douglas J. Harvey, Michael J. Lombardini, Meaghan Mott, Ruthann Schinzing, Scott Townsend Absent: none Staff Present: Tammy Turgeon III. Approval of Agenda Motion made by Harvey to approve the agenda, seconded by Connor. Motion carried. IV. Minutes of November 6, 2014 Minutes of the November 6, 2014 meeting were approved on a motion by Lombardini, supported by Schinzing. Motion carried. V. Communications/Reports/Correspondence Commission members continue to receive local historical groups’ newsletters forwarded to them via email. Turgeon tried to attend MCHA meeting in January, but it was cancelled. DiMaria indicated that tours should be hosted by all commission members. Loa will send a reminder to members that volunteer for specific dates. We need to have two members for each tour. VI. Unfinished Business A. Sterling Christmas DiMaria thanked members for undecorating the house. $43.35 was received in donations. There were 335 visitors. Commission discussed sending out a letter to local businesses asking for a 8’ prelit tree to replace the one in the foyer. Commission would ask families to bring an ornament during Sterling Christmas and we would keep them for the tree each year. Motion was made by Schinzing to solicit local businesses to donate a tree to be used as the Sterling Heights Community Family Tree, seconded by Lombardini. Motion carried. B. Names Project Still working on. C. Oral History Conversion Project Turgeon has completed 13 of the oral histories into MP3 format. It is a slow process. Mott suggested flagging transcripts that are not complete so that someone could work on those. D. Wikipedia Page Lombardini is working on this. E. Upton House Tours Pamphlet Turgeon will get this put on the website. F. Historical Display in Library Thank you to Jeff Norgrove for creating a Vietnam War display for the case. One idea for the next display was to show SH government through the years. G. Clippings and Scrapbook Harvey still has some clipping work at home. If other commissioners are interested, please let Turgeon or Debbie V. know. H. Historical Marker Program Applications are available online and in the library. We have not received any yet. Harvey would like a picture of the plaque. Turgeon will find out if a list of older homes can be generated through the city. I. Macomb County Heritage Alliance – Patch Program DiMaria indicated that scouts want to purchase patches when they go on the tour. Turgeon will make sure some patches are available in the desk to sell. This option could also be mentioned when a scout group books a tour so they can be purchased ahead of time. VII. New Business A. Fall Magazine Article Mott may do an article on the Clinton River. Someone will need to commit at the May meeting. The article is due by mid-July. B. May Historical Commission Program Commission discussed May program topics. Mott will get Turgeon a contact for a program about Michigan and the Civil War. An alternative subject would be Amelia Earhart. VIII. Communications from Citizens None IX. Adjourn A motion was made by Connor to adjourn, seconded by Townsend. Motion carried. Meeting adjourned at 7:03 p.m. Next meeting: May 7, 2015 at 6 p.m.
